In this episode, I chat with Jenni Nellist who is a Clinical Animal Behaviouralist. She helps caring horse and dog owners struggling with their animal's problem behaviour to get a deeper understanding,  remove stress, restore partnerships, and change behaviour. Together we chat about: Her journey with horses up until when she started university Her studies in Equine Science Her project which looked at herd dynamics in a group of mares when a stallion was and wasn't present How she would use positive reinforcement to help rehabilitate horses Some science around different weaning protocols and some more ethical ways of doing it for pleasure and performance horses How stress early in a horses life can predispose them to gut issues, picking up vices, nervous behaviour etc.  How important it is to continue to learn and collaborate with others And so much more!
